description Product Description

Monodisperse carboxy silica microspheres are widely used in biomedical research and diagnostics due to their uniform size and surface functionality. These microspheres serve as excellent carriers for drug delivery systems, enabling controlled release and targeted therapy. Their carboxyl groups allow for easy conjugation with biomolecules, such as antibodies, peptides, or DNA, making them valuable in immunoassays, biosensors, and molecular diagnostics.

In chromatography, they are employed as stationary phases for high-resolution separation of proteins, nucleic acids, and other biomolecules. Their consistent size and surface properties ensure reproducibility and efficiency in analytical applications. Additionally, they are utilized in cell sorting and imaging techniques, where their uniform characteristics enhance accuracy and reliability.

These microspheres also find applications in material science, acting as building blocks for creating structured materials with precise properties. Their functionalized surface facilitates the development of advanced composites, coatings, and catalysts. Overall, their versatility and tunable properties make them indispensable in various scientific and industrial fields.
